]> git.baikalelectronics.ru Git - kernel.git/commit
drm/amd/display: Limit max DSC target bpp for specific monitors
authorRoman Li <Roman.Li@amd.com>
Fri, 30 Jul 2021 22:30:41 +0000 (18:30 -0400)
committerAlex Deucher <alexander.deucher@amd.com>
Wed, 1 Sep 2021 20:55:10 +0000 (16:55 -0400)
commitbd4d637062c20ea739ae00d92941d1f26ab51fc4
tree31de12fb81096da10d71c78236455884fa740932
parent9feba6323d6c6e7a73db9f00f400922fe8cc7ffc
drm/amd/display: Limit max DSC target bpp for specific monitors

[Why]
Some monitors exhibit corruption at 16bpp DSC.

[How]
- Add helpers for patching edid caps.
- Use it for limiting DSC target bitrate to 15bpp for known monitors

Reviewed-by: Rodrigo Siqueira <Rodrigo.Siqueira@amd.com>
Acked-by: Qingqing Zhuo <qingqing.zhuo@amd.com>
Signed-off-by: Roman Li <Roman.Li@amd.com>
Cc: stable@vger.kernel.org
Tested-by: Daniel Wheeler <Daniel.Wheeler@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m_helpers.c